Why Are My Hydrangeas Green Instead Of White. The good news is there are 5 potential reasons for your hydrangea blooms to turn green, and none threaten the plant. Many white hydrangeas, especially smooth hydrangeas ( hydrangea arborescens ) will naturally turn green as they age. Hydrangea leaves turn light green due to nutrient deficiencies, soil ph imbalance, inadequate sunlight, overwatering, pests, diseases, or temperature stress.
